An Access Point Name (APN) is a profile stored on your phone that provides the network with vital information: The mandatory IP address path. The specific network type (e.g., internet, MMS, IMS). The correct security protocols and encryption methods.
APN settings, or Access Point Name settings, are a set of configurations that allow your mobile device to connect to a specific network, such as the internet or a private network.
